Excessive Sleepiness What is it? Excessive sleepiness is feeling very tired or drowsy during the day. It is often confused with fatigue, but they are different struggles. Excessive Sleepiness vs Fatigue Fatigue is dealing with low energy. You can be physically, mentally, or emotionally fatigued. This is usually a result of either a medical condition or overusing your body or mind. Excessive Sleepiness makes you feel so tired that it ends up interfering with your daily life. Excessive sleepiness is often a sign you may have a sleep disorder that is keeping you from getting the sleep you need to function. Treatment Since excessive sleepiness is not actually a condition, but a symptom, the best way to treat it is by determining the cause. What is our natural clock? Our body's natural Circadian Biological Clock regulates the timing of periods of sleepiness and wakefulness throughout the day. Your body's circadian rhythm dips and rises throughout the day. Adults usually experience the largest dips during early morning times around 2 to 4 am and afternoon. Making sure that you have had plenty of rest will help you to avoid a serious dip in the afternoon that can leave you feeling drowsy at work. Changes to your natural clock You may notice that your teen seems to suddenly be sleeping in and staying up late. This is due to changes in their circadian rhythm. What is acupuncture? Acupuncture is a technique in which practitioners stimulate specific points on the body. This is most often done by inserting thin needles. Are there risks? The main risk from acupuncture is non-sterile needles and incorrect delivery. Make sure that when you are scheduling your acupuncture you go with a professional with a sound reputation and a very clean office. Most states require a diploma from the National Certification Commission for Acupuncture and Oriental Medicine for licensing to practice acupuncture. Benefits Acupuncture is used by many to treat pain, stress, headaches, and more. Relieving your body of stress and pain can lead to being able to fall asleep faster and sleep better. Those who suffer from insomnia can also find relief after acupuncture.
